There is great botanical tradition behind these terms – truly, “sativa” and “ indica ” are originally distinct; they were first distinguished by different European botanists in the 18th and 19th centuries. But :
Q4 Capital
+1
the modern cannabis market is almost exclusively populated by hybrid plants – a pure sativa or pure indica plant barely exists in the modern world. Genetics are manipulated in all directions to enhance THC content and yields. Most likely, the distinction between sativa and indica is much less pure than marketing would suggest.
